I Love Lucy - Season 1 Vol 2
THE STRAIGHT DOPE:
With volume 1 of the I Love Lucy DVD series covering the "lost" pilot and the first three episodes, volume 2 continues with the next four. These episodes help illustrate why I Love Lucy remains one of the most highly-regarded sitcoms ever aired. The first episode on the disc, the wonderfully titled "Lucy Thinks Ricky Is Trying To Murder Her" epitomizes the comedic style that the show traded on: Lucy misunderstands something Ricky has said to someone else and interprets something completely inappropriate. The next episode, "The Quiz Show," also finds Lucy hilariously trying to work through a mistake. "The Audition" and "The Seance" both find Lucy hamming it up in weird situations, first as Buffo the Clown, a character similar to one she played in the first disc's pilot, and then as a believer in the supernatural.
VIDEO:
The video on this disc is once again well-done. The black and white images have been lovingly restored and, considering the source, look very nice.
AUDIO:
The Dolby Digital mono audio is also very good. Carefully restored, these shows probably sound better than they ever have before. A Spanish mono track is also available.
EXTRAS:
Once again, an impressive selection of extras is available. This disc contains two Lucy radio shows, both great additions. A selection of flubs taken from the episodes on the disc, like the easily-missed moment when a studio camera enters the frame, is included, as well as footage added for the shows' many years of reruns. The behind the scenes section, however, is only a photo gallery this time.
FINAL THOUGHTS:
Paramount should really release a box set of Lucy DVDs, but in the meantime these discs are perfect for fans. While it's not a bad idea to pick discs based on which episodes are each viewer's personal favorites, the serious Lucy fan will want them all.
